The government issued the order on June 15, 2017, to promote manufacturing & production of goods and services in India & enhance income and employment in the country. A tender worth Rs 8,000 cr was withdrawn & re-issued with modified conditions after the intervention of the DIPP. The project was related with setting up of a urea and ammonia plant for gasification.
